Can a plumber afford rent in Ojai, CA?
Median rent in Ojai is $3,706 a month. A typical plumber in California earns about $79,178 a year, which makes that rent 56.2% of gross monthly income. Under the 30% rule, the answer is no — rent exceeds the 30% threshold.
How much rent can a plumber afford in Ojai?
Using the 30% rule, a plumber salary in California (~$79,178/yr) supports up to $1,979 a month in rent. Ojai's current median rent is $3,706/mo, which is $1,727/mo over the affordability threshold.
How many hours does a plumber work to cover rent in Ojai?
At an hourly equivalent of about $38 an hour, a plumber in California works roughly 97.4 hours a month to cover Ojai's median rent of $3,706.
